Harness the Power of Breath: Deep Breathing Exercises

Our breath is a powerful tool that can be used to improve our physical, mental, and emotional well-being. Deep breathing exercises are a simple yet effective way to tap into this power and experience a range of benefits. Whether you are looking to reduce stress, increase focus, or improve your overall health, incorporating deep breathing exercises into your daily routine can make a significant difference.

Benefits of Deep Breathing Exercises:

  • Reduces stress and anxiety levels
  • Increases oxygen supply to the brain and body
  • Improves focus and concentration
  • Helps lower blood pressure
  • Promotes relaxation and calms the mind
  • Enhances lung function

Types of Deep Breathing Exercises:

There are various techniques you can try to engage in deep breathing. Here are a few popular ones:

  1. Diaphragmatic Breathing: Also known as belly breathing, this technique involves breathing deeply into your diaphragm to fully expand your lungs.
  2. 4-7-8 Breathing: Inhale for a count of 4, hold your breath for a count of 7, and exhale for a count of 8. Repeat several times.
  3. Nostril Breathing: Close one nostril and breathe in and out through the other, then switch sides.

How to Practice Deep Breathing:

Find a comfortable and quiet place to sit or lie down. Close your eyes and focus on your breath. Inhale deeply through your nose, feeling your abdomen rise, then exhale slowly through your mouth. Repeat this process for a few minutes, allowing your body and mind to relax with each breath.
